Irvine's HVAC Search Intent: Emergency vs. Planned Maintenance
Irvine homeowners exhibit distinct search behaviors for HVAC services, bifurcated by immediate need versus preventative planning. During summer heatwaves, queries like 'AC repair Irvine' or 'HVAC emergency University Park' spike, demanding instant mobile load times and clear calls-to-action for urgent service. These users are not browsing; they are converting. Conversely, searches for 'HVAC maintenance Irvine' or 'new AC installation Tustin Legacy' indicate planned intent, where users spend more time evaluating energy efficiency (SEER ratings), NATE certifications, and detailed service offerings. Your website's architecture must dynamically cater to both, with schema markup distinguishing emergency services from routine maintenance to capture specific Google SERP features. The top 3 Irvine HVAC sites consistently use 'Service' schema to highlight 24/7 availability and 'Product' schema for specific high-efficiency units, a strategy 90% of competitors overlook.

Irvine HVAC Contractor Schema Markup: The Local Signal 90% of Sites Miss
Effective schema markup is not optional for Irvine HVAC Contractors; it is foundational for local search dominance. While most sites implement basic 'LocalBusiness' schema, the top-performing Irvine HVAC sites leverage advanced 'Service' and 'Product' schema to detail their specific offerings, such as 'Furnace Repair' or 'Duct Cleaning,' and even specific brands like 'Carrier AC Installation.' This granular data allows Google to understand precisely what services are offered and where, enhancing visibility for long-tail queries. Crucially, these sites also embed 'Review' schema to aggregate customer feedback, directly influencing the star ratings displayed in local pack results. Without this precise, Irvine-centric schema implementation, Google struggles to confidently match your services to specific homeowner needs, leaving your business behind the 59 other contractors vying for attention in areas like Northwood and Portola Springs.
